NOVELTY - Preparing tin selenide/graphene-coated cotton carbon fiber self-supporting material comprises (i) dissolving sodium hydroxide and selenium powder in deionized water, adding citric acid and stannous chloride, stirring uniformly, centrifuging, removing the precipitate, and adding deionized water to obtain tin selenide solution; (ii) immersing non-woven cotton in graphite oxide solution and performing ultrasonic treatment; (iii) freezing and drying to obtain oxidized graphene-coated non-woven cotton fiber; (iv) immersing the oxidized graphene-coated non-woven cotton fiber in tin selenide solution, taking out and drying in a drying box; (v) adding into a furnace, introducing protective gas, and keeping at 400-1000 degrees C for 1-10 hours; and (vi) stopping heating, continuously introducing protective gas, and cooling the furnace to room temperature, and taking out the sample. USE - The method is useful for preparing tin selenide/graphene-coated cotton carbon fiber self-supporting material.
